Hiking trails around Beaumont-De-Pertuis are situated within the Luberon Regional Nature Park, offering diverse landscapes for outdoor activities. The area features rolling hills, forests, vineyards, and olive groves, with the Durance River providing scenic riverside paths. This region is characterized by varied terrain, from gentle valleys to more elevated sections, providing a range of experiences for hikers.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Beaumont-De-Pertuis?

There are nearly 90 hiking trails around Beaumont-De-Pertuis, offering a wide range of options for all skill levels. This includes 33 easy routes, 50 moderate routes, and 4 challenging trails.

What kind of landscapes can I expect to see while hiking in Beaumont-De-Pertuis?

Hiking in Beaumont-De-Pertuis, nestled within the Luberon Regional Nature Park, offers diverse landscapes. You'll encounter rolling hills, picturesque views of the Durance River, and trails winding through coniferous and deciduous forests. The area also showcases its agricultural heritage with vineyards and olive groves, and in spring, you can enjoy garrigue in bloom, while early summer brings the scent of lavender fields.

Are there easy hiking options suitable for beginners or casual walkers?

Yes, there are plenty of easy hiking options. For instance, the View of the Durance loop from Chapelle Notre-Dame de Beauvoir is an easy 6 km (3.8 mi) path that provides scenic views of the Durance and passes by the historic Notre-Dame de Beauvoir Chapel.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ions I can see along the hiking trails?

Many trails offer glimpses of the region's rich history and natural beauty. You might pass by historic chapels like Notre-Dame de Beauvoir, or enjoy views of the Durance River and the Mirabeau Bridge. The area is also dotted with ancient structures like bories (dry stone huts) and old mills, offering insights into the past.

Are there any circular hiking routes in the area?

Yes, many of the trails around Beaumont-De-Pertuis are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. An example is the View of the Durance loop from Les Dorguons, a 6.5 km (4.0 mi) trail that leads through varied landscapes with views of the Durance.

What do other hikers enjoy most about hiking in Beaumont-De-Pertuis?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.3 stars from over 140 reviews. Hikers often praise the diverse landscapes, the tranquility of the Luberon Regional Nature Park, and the scenic views of the Durance River and surrounding hills.

Is Beaumont-De-Pertuis a good destination for family-friendly hikes?

Yes, the region offers several family-friendly routes, particularly among the 33 easy trails available. These paths often feature gentle terrain and picturesque scenery, making them suitable for families looking to enjoy nature together. The diverse flora and fauna, including potential sightings of rare birds of prey, can also be engaging for children.

Can I bring my dog on the hiking trails in Beaumont-De-Pertuis?

Many trails in the Luberon Regional Nature Park are dog-friendly, but it's always advisable to keep your dog on a leash, especially in areas with wildlife or near agricultural lands. The diverse natural environment provides plenty of opportunities for you and your canine companion to explore together.

What is the best time of year to go hiking in Beaumont-De-Pertuis?

Spring and early summer are particularly beautiful times to hike. In spring, you can enjoy the garrigue in bloom, while early summer brings the fragrant lavender fields. The mild weather during these seasons also makes for comfortable hiking conditions.

Are there any longer, more challenging hikes for experienced trekkers?

For those seeking a greater challenge, there are 4 difficult routes available. An example of a moderate, longer route is the Magnificent tower – Mirabeau Bridge loop from Mirabeau, which covers 13.6 km (8.5 mi) and involves significant elevation changes, offering a more strenuous experience.

Where can I find parking for the hiking trailheads?

Parking is generally available near the starting points of popular trails and in the villages. For routes like the Mirabeau Market – Mirabeau Bridge loop from Mirabeau, you can typically find parking in Mirabeau itself or designated areas nearby.

What kind of wildlife might I encounter on the trails?

The Luberon Regional Nature Park is home to diverse flora and fauna. Hikers might observe over 270 different species of vertebrates, including rare birds of prey like Bonelli's eagle. The natural flora also supports a variety of insects and smaller mammals.
